The song mentions General Meagher-an Irishman who made it by hook and crook to Americay. His celebrity and allegiance to the Union Cause made him a perfect political appointment to raise Irishmen to "fight for Lincoln." He was given the brevet rank of Brigadier General, around whom the Army of the Potomac's Irish Brigade was formed; not to be confused with Corcoran's Legion.
